First Impressions: Is It as Sleek as It Looks?
The stainless steel finish immediately caught my eye. It’s modern, clean, and adds a touch of elegance to the kitchen counter. At 10.13″ x 10.38″ x 14.25″, it’s compact enough for small spaces but still robust. However, lifting the machine revealed its 12.2-pound weight, which reassured me of its sturdiness. The buttons felt tactile, and the programmable feature promised convenience. However, I’ll admit, I was a tad intimidated by the dual functionality at first glance.
Putting It to the Test: Dual Brewing Magic
Let me paint a picture: It’s a Monday morning, and I’m running late. The single-serve side comes to the rescue. Using a K-Cup pod, I brewed a quick 10-ounce cup. The 40-ounce removable reservoir was a lifesaver—you don’t need to refill it every single time. Bonus points for the Brew Pause feature, which let me sneak a cup mid-brew without making a mess.
Fast forward to Sunday brunch. Family gathered around, and the 12-cup carafe took center stage. The adjustable auto-off kept my coffee warm while we chatted. The brew strength control meant my strong-coffee-loving aunt and my light-coffee-preferring cousin were both happy. It’s versatile, no doubt.
The Good, the Bad, and the Splashes
One thing I noticed: the single-serve drip tray is removable, which is great for travel mugs. However, when brewing smaller sizes, splashes were a bit of an issue. I also found the water reservoir opening on the carafe side a little tight—it’s not ideal for clumsy early mornings.
Comparing to Competitors
Having used the Hamilton Beach FlexBrew before, I can confidently say the Cuisinart SS-15P1 wins in the brew strength and design quality categories. The Hamilton Beach is bulkier and lacks the finesse of the Cuisinart’s wedge-shaped basket, which ensures better coffee extraction. On the flip side, the Keurig K-Duo is easier to refill, but its single water reservoir wasn’t as efficient for switching between modes.

How to Use Guide
- Set Up the Machine: Place the coffee maker on a flat surface and plug it in. Install the charcoal water filter in the designated spot.
- Fill Reservoirs: For the carafe side, pour water into the well using the carafe. For the single-serve side, fill the 40-ounce removable reservoir.
- Choose Your Brewing Mode: Decide between the single-serve or carafe mode using the selector switch.
- Brew Single-Serve Coffee: Insert a pod or use the reusable filter with your ground coffee. Select your cup size (6, 8, or 10 ounces) and press “brew.”
- Brew a Carafe: Add a coffee filter to the wedge-shaped basket. Scoop your desired amount of coffee grounds. Close the lid, set the brew strength, and press “brew.”
- Pause Mid-Brew (Carafe): Use the Brew Pause feature to pour a cup before the cycle is complete.
- Cleaning: Use the Auto Clean function regularly to maintain performance.
